Warning Signs You Need Dehumidification Services

Moisture damage can be sneaky. It doesn’t always announce itself with visible water. But there are signs you can’t ignore. Catching them early can save you time, money, and stress. That’s why it’s important to know what to look for. If you see any of these signs, it’s time to call a professional.

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away

A damp smell in your home is a sign that moisture is hiding somewhere. It can come from walls, floors, or even your attic. This smell doesn’t go away with air fresheners. It means mold or mildew is growing. You need to act fast to prevent health issues and further damage. Don’t ignore it. It’s a warning that something is wrong.

Water Stains on Ceilings or Walls

Stains on your ceiling or walls are a clear sign of moisture. They can appear after a leak or a flood. These stains don’t just look bad, they mean water is trapped in your home. If left untreated, it can lead to structural damage. You need to address the source of the moisture before it causes more harm. This isn’t just a cosmetic issue.

Peeling Paint or Bubbling Wallpaper

Paint that peels or wallpaper that bubbles is a sign of hidden moisture. It can happen in areas that aren’t easily visible. The moisture is trapped behind the surface, causing damage over time. This is a red flag that something is wrong. You need to check the source of the moisture to prevent it from spreading. Don’t let it get worse.

Damp or Soggy Floors

If your floors feel damp or soggy, it’s a sign of water damage. This can happen after a flood or a plumbing leak. It can also be a sign of poor drainage around your home. Moisture in the floor can lead to mold and structural issues. You need to address it right away. Don’t wait, this kind of damage can be expensive to fix later.

Condensation on Windows or Walls

Excessive condensation on windows or walls is a sign that humidity levels are too high. It can lead to mold growth and damage to your home. This is especially common in areas with high humidity. You need to manage the moisture levels before they cause more problems. A dehumidifier can help, but professional help is often needed for deep-seated issues.

Visible Mold Growth

Spotting mold in your home is a serious issue. It can grow in hidden areas like behind walls or under floors. Mold can cause health problems and reduce the value of your home. You need to act quickly to remove it. But stopping the moisture source is just as important. If you don’t, the mold will come back. This is a sign that professional help is needed.

Dehumidification Services vs. DIY: When To Call a Professional

Situation DIY? Call a Pro? Why
Small area with visible moisture Yes No It’s manageable with a dehumidifier and fans. But don’t ignore hidden moisture.
Water under a carpet No Yes Moisture trapped under the carpet can lead to mold and structural damage. A professional is needed to dry it properly.
Leak under the sink Yes No Fix the leak and use a dehumidifier. But don’t skip inspecting the area for hidden damage.
Basement with high humidity No Yes High humidity can lead to mold and poor air quality. A professional can assess the best solution for your space.
Mold on walls No Yes Mold needs to be removed and the moisture source fixed. A professional has the tools and knowledge to do this safely.
Old home with water damage No Yes Older homes can have hidden issues that a DIY approach can’t fix. A professional will check for structural damage and mold.

How long does Dehumidification take?

The time depends on the size of the area and the amount of moisture. It usually takes 2-7 days. We monitor the progress daily and adjust as needed. You get updates throughout the process. We don’t rush it. We make sure the job is done right.

What are the health risks of not fixing moisture issues?

Mold and mildew can cause respiratory problems, allergies, and other health issues. They spread quickly and can be hard to remove. You don’t want to ignore the signs. A professional can help stop the problem before it affects your family’s health. It’s worth the investment.

How do I prevent future moisture damage?

Keep your home well-ventilated and check for leaks regularly. Use a dehumidifier in damp areas. We can also help you identify and fix the sources of moisture. It’s all about staying proactive. You don’t have to wait for a problem to occur. We’ll help you prevent it.
